Uh-oh! Katla Volcano Just Rumbled
17 May 10 - The Iceland Met office reports that a small earthquake has occurred at the Katla location. Although a single earthquake does not guarantee an eruption, it could be the first ’sigh’ of the awakening giant. Historically, Katla has erupted after the eruption of its close neighbor, Eyjafjallajokull. A Katla eruption would likely be about ten times as powerful at the Eyjafjallajokull eruption and could cause worldwide disruption while expelling huge volumes of volcanic ash into the stratosphere which could circle the globe potentially for years.
